Accountability conversations are the prickly, complicated, and often frightening performance discussions that are uncomfortable.

In high-functioning teams, each person takes responsibility and is accountable for his or her actions and the impact they may have on the team. But what happens when someone fails to complete his or her assignment? The question must then be asked, “Why didn’t you keep your commitment?”

When implemented successfully, healthy and open dialogues create solutions in which both parties are able to comply and the relationship is strengthened. Avoiding such conversations brings down an organization’s morale, time, and resources.

Accountability Training teaches participants how to talk about violated expectations in a manner that allows for progress and productivity. It identifies the key warning signs of individuals who are shirking their duties, and it provides strategies on how to create an environment where it’s easy for your staff to take responsibility for their decisions and actions. Consistent application of the skills learned will lead to faster problem-solving, decision-making, and conflict resolution.

This program is a companion to Critical Conversations, yet can be a stand-alone course. Using a similar model, this training deals with a subset of the interactions and pivotal concepts in the crucial conversations training.
